ABSTRACT

BACKGROUND:

Coronavirus disease 2019, which is caused by the new severe acute respiratory syndrome coronavirus 2, became a pandemic in 2020 with a mortality rate of 2% and high transmissibility, thus making studies with an epidemiological profile essential.

OBJECTIVES:

The aim of this study was to characterize the population that performed the severe acute respiratory syndrome coronavirus 2 molecular and serological tests in Carlos Chagas Laboratory - Sabin Group in Cuiabá.

METHODS:

A retrospective cross-sectional study was carried out with all the samples collected from nasal swab tested by RT-PCR and serological for severe acute respiratory syndrome coronavirus 2 IgM/IgG from the population served between April and December 2020.

FINDINGS:

In the analysis period, 23,631 PCR-coronavirus disease 2019 examinations were registered. Of this total number of cases, 7,649 (32.37%) tested positive, while 15,982 (66.31%) did not detect viral RNA and 374 of the results as undetermined. The peak of positive RT-PCR performed in July (n=5,878), with 35.65% (n=2,096). A total of 8,884 tests were performed on serological test SOROVID-19, with a peak of 1,169 (57.16%) of the positive tests for severe acute respiratory syndrome coronavirus 2 in July. MAIN

CONCLUSIONS:

Molecular positivity and serological tests, both peaked in July 2020, were mostly present in women aged 20-59 years, characterizing Cuiabá as the epicenter of the Midwest region in this period due to the high rate of transmissibility of severe acute respiratory syndrome coronavirus 2.
